文章
17
粉丝
43
获赞
10
访问
13.9k
注意
整行包括空格输入采用getline
多组输入 while
注意空格和.双重判断
如果碰到空格则输出并且重新统计,不是空格则累加
#include<bits/stdc++.h>
using namespace std;
int main(){
string s;
while(getline(cin,s))
{
int cnt=0;
for(int i=0;i<s.size();i++)
{
if(s[i]==' '||s[i]=='.')
{
if(cnt>0)
{
cout<<cnt<<" ";
}
cnt=0;
}
else{
cnt++;
}
}
}
return 0;
}
登录后发布评论
暂无评论,来抢沙发